My Buying Guides on Keys For Window Locks

Why I Care About the Right Window Lock Key

When I started looking for keys for window locks, I realized not all replacement keys are the same. I wanted something that fit properly, worked smoothly, and gave me confidence that my windows stayed secure. For me, the right key is not just about convenience—it is about safety, ease of use, and avoiding damage to the lock.

What I Check Before Buying

The first thing I do is identify the exact type of window lock I have. I look at the lock brand, model number, and any markings on the key or cylinder. If I cannot find those details, I compare the shape of the keyway and the lock style. I have learned that guessing usually leads to buying the wrong key.

Compatibility Matters Most

My biggest priority is compatibility. A key may look similar, but if it is not made for that specific window lock, it may not turn properly or may get stuck. I always make sure the replacement key matches the lock type, whether it is for a casement window, sash window, sliding window, or a keyed window latch.

Material and Build Quality

I prefer keys made from strong metal because they last longer and resist bending. Cheap keys can wear down quickly, especially if I use them often. A solid build gives me more confidence that the key will not snap or damage the lock over time.

Ease of Use

I like keys that insert and turn smoothly without forcing them. If I have to wiggle the key too much, I know something is off. A good window lock key should feel secure but not overly tight. For me, smooth operation is a sign of a better fit and better quality.

Security Considerations

I also think about security before buying. If I am replacing a lost key, I make sure the lock is still secure and that no unauthorized copies are floating around. In some cases, I choose to replace the lock cylinder as well, especially if I am unsure who might have access to the old key.

Buying from a Trusted Seller

I always try to buy from a trusted supplier or manufacturer. That helps me avoid poor-quality replacements and gives me a better chance of getting the exact key I need. I also check reviews when possible because other buyers often mention fit, durability, and ease of use.

Having the Right Information Ready

Before I order, I gather as much information as I can:

  • Lock brand or manufacturer
  • Model or part number
  • Photos of the lock and keyway
  • Measurements if needed
  • Any code stamped on the original key

Having this ready saves me time and reduces the chance of ordering the wrong item.

When I Replace the Whole Lock Instead

Sometimes I find that buying just a key is not enough. If the lock is old, damaged, or the key is missing and no code is available, I consider replacing the entire lock. In my experience, this can be the better long-term choice because it restores both function and security.

My Final Advice

My main advice is to match the key carefully to the lock, choose good-quality materials, and buy from a reliable source. I have found that taking a little extra time upfront saves me frustration later. A proper window lock key should fit well, work easily, and help keep my home secure.
